Frequently Asked Questions about Hawaii County

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Hawaii County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Hawaii County ranges from $1,500 to $2,400 with an average monthly rent of $1,870.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Hawaii County c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Hawaii County range from $1,650 to $3,200.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,512.

How expensive are Hawaii County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 29 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Hawaii County on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,900 to $3,800 - averaging $3,058 for the location.
